The cinematic universe is the new trend in Indian cinema today which is spreading to all the industries today in cinema. Hollywood started this trend by bringing famous characters from one film to another film story and giving a lead to the next part of the film. This trend started with Simbaa in Bollywood and Vikram in Kollywood. In Kollywood, the cinematic universe is a huge hit, and every film by director Lokesh Kanagaraj is seen as part of the Lokesh Cinematic Universe (LCU). Will this cinematic universe come to Kannada also?
A big yes seems to be the answer and the news is spread fast in the industry. MG Srinis heist thriller Ghost with Shivarajkumar is progressing rapidly and is having huge expectations for the film. The film is keenly watched as MG Srini is constantly bringing in many creative ideas and technologies to excite the fans. Firstly, the casting of other industry actors like Jayaram from Malayalam and Anupam Kher from Bollywood made huge news and then came the de-aging technology being used to show Shivarajkumars young avatar in the film and the results have been satisfactory for the team.
Now another big news is that director MG Srini is trying to bring the cinematic universe into the Kannada cinema. MG Srinis crime thriller Birbal released in 2019, was a surprise hit and got a lot of positive reviews. Apart from directing, MG Srini played the protagonist Lawyer Mahesh Das. Now MG Srini is bringing the characters Mahesh Das and others from Birbal as part of the narration in Ghost. This is going to be exciting for Kannada movie buffs to see the cinematic universe unravel after the release of the film. If this cinematic universe is accepted by the audience, we can see a flood of the cinematic universe being made in Kannada cinemas soon.
